In the 21st century, with the rapid advancement of science and technology, science education has become a focal point in the school education system, aligning with the changing needs of society and the goal of holistic development outlined in the NEP 2020.
'The National Science Teachers workshops' aim to gather innovative, dedicated educators from across the country to promote experiential learning, emphasize key concepts, and encourage problem-solving skills. Participants will share teaching methodologies and innovations in activity-based learning. Panel discussions will cover various aspects of science education, including effective tools for comprehensive learning. The workshop also aims to leverage science education as a means for nation-building through Science, Technology, and Innovation, culminating in a report based on discussions and dissertations.
Dates: 17 to 20 January 2024
Venue: DBT THSTI-RCB Campus
